2020-21 - Junior
Competed in all nine rounds, posting an average of 87.8 which was good for second on the squad... led the Rams in two events, taking first place overall versus Adelphi and in a tri-match against Dominican (N.Y.) and East Stroudsburg... had a top score of 79 in the final match of the year versus Dominican (N.Y.) and East Stroudsburg... D2 ADA Academic Achievement Award

2019-20
Played in all seven rounds during the fall before the COVID-19 pandemic cancelled the spring schedule... led the Rams in six of the seven rounds and had a team-best 83.7 average... posted two rounds in the 70s with a low score of 73 in Round One of the Revolutionary Classic... finished in the top 10 in all five events, including the individual title at the Revolutionary Classic... Received the D2 ADA Academic Achievement Award

2018-19 - Sophomore
Played in all 20 rounds… averaged 87.2 strokes… shot her best round of 81 (+11) at the second day of the Revolutionary Classic... was the Rams' top finisher at the Ursinus Invitational and Alvernia Fall Invitational.

2017-18 – Freshman
Played in all nine matches in the inaugural year of the women’s golf program…Averaged 88.0 strokes per round…Turned in her best round of 81 from Patriots Glen National Golf Club against Ursinus/Widener on April 8.

Background
Attended Nazareth Academy High School in Philadelphia, Pa., graduating in May 2017…A four-time varsity letter and four-time MVP of her high school team…Earned Commended Honors…Member of Student Council.
